John Deere 6250R vs Wagner WA-17
Side-by-side specs comparison
Verdict by the numbers
- The John Deere 6250R and the Wagner WA-17 deliver the same power: 250 HP.
- The John Deere 6250R is the more recent model: production started in 2016, versus 1961 for the Wagner WA-17.
- The Wagner WA-17 is heavier: 12247 kg versus 9300 kg for the John Deere 6250R.
Full specs comparison
| John Deere 6250R | Wagner WA-17 | |
|---|---|---|
| Power | 250 HP | 250 HP |
| Production years | 2016+ | 1961–1969 |
| Fuel | Diesel | Diesel |
| Cylinders | 6 | 6 |
| Displacement | 6.8 L | 14 L |
| Weight | 9 300 kg | 12 247 kg |
| Drive | 4WD | 4WD |
| Transmission | CVT | — |
| Gears (fwd/rev) | — | 10 / 2 |
| Rear lift capacity | 6 999 kg | — |
| Wheelbase | 290 cm | 345 cm |
| Length | 518 cm | 624 cm |
| Cab | Yes | Yes |
